From: miker Date: Fri, 27 Jul 2007 16:53:11 +0000 (+0000) Subject: remove extra xml declarations X-Git-Url: https://old-git.evergreen-ils.org/?a=commitdiff_plain;h=ea8a861c921d31171ae5e2d0c3488c31a4a7b203;p=Evergreen.git remove extra xml declarations git-svn-id: svn://svn.open-ils.org/ILS/trunk@7594 dcc99617-32d9-48b4-a31d-7c20da2025e4 --- diff --git a/Open-ILS/src/perlmods/OpenILS/WWW/Exporter.pm b/Open-ILS/src/perlmods/OpenILS/WWW/Exporter.pm index 6871fee23d..b41b635450 100644 --- a/Open-ILS/src/perlmods/OpenILS/WWW/Exporter.pm +++ b/Open-ILS/src/perlmods/OpenILS/WWW/Exporter.pm @@ -193,7 +193,9 @@ Content-type: application/xml } if (uc($format) eq 'XML') { - print $r->as_xml_record; + my $x = $r->as_xml_record; + $x =~ s/^<\?xml version="1.0" encoding="UTF-8"\?>//o; + print $x; } elsif (uc($format) eq 'UNIMARC') { print $r->as_unimarc } elsif (uc($format) eq 'USMARC') {